PHED 131 - Tennis-Racquetball

For players on every level. An introduction to the techniques and rules required for participants in the sports of tennis and racquetball. Students will review the basic skills of serving, forehand and backhand strokes and game strategy will be discussed. The first half of the semester will be devoted to learning tennis and the second half of the semester racquetball. (Offered fall semester) (1 Credit)
